ACREAGE
The ranch boasts extensive water rights, complemented by ponds and roughly 5.5 miles of live water along Beaver Creek and Butler Creek, offering limited fishing opportunities. Multiple irrigation ditches and seasonal drainages further enhance the property’s water resources, supporting both livestock and wildlife.
With a focus on livestock production and recreational use, the land’s premier natural features are safeguarded by a conservation easement. Ranging in elevation from approximately 8,200 to 9,200 feet, the ranch sits at an ideal height for enjoying summer and fall activities in the Central Rockies. The landscape transitions gracefully from mixed timber to open meadows and mountain pastures, eventually flowing into irrigated hay fields and willow-lined stream corridors.
HUNTING/WILDLIFE
The property’s mixed timber, open meadows, and water resources provide excellent habitat for many wildlife species. The ranch is in GMU16. There is an abundance of wildlife in the surrounding neighborhood that are common to the ranch including elk, mule deer, pronghorn, bear, and moose. Grouse are also common. With current ownership and management, there has been limited hunting pressure on the ranch.
AREA/LOCATION
The ranch is located about 21 miles southwest of Walden, around 40 miles northwest of Kremmling, and around 55 miles to Steamboat Springs (via Rabbit Ears Pass). North Park and the surrounding area are characterized by a somewhat sparse population, long revered for its ranching and recreation – within a short travel distance from regional airports and services.
